What is a Crypto Debit Card?

A crypto debit card is a payment card that allows users to spend their cryptocurrency at any merchant that accepts debit cards. These cards work by converting the cryptocurrency into fiat currency at the point of sale. The user's cryptocurrency balance is debited, and the merchant receives the payment in the local currency. This process is seamless and allows users to spend their cryptocurrency without having to exchange it first.

How Do Crypto Debit Cards Work?

Crypto debit cards work by connecting to a user's cryptocurrency wallet. When a user makes a purchase with their card, the wallet is debited, and the crypto is converted to fiat currency through a payment processor. The payment is then sent to the merchant in the local currency.

Some crypto debit cards also offer the option to withdraw cash from an ATM. In this case, the cryptocurrency is converted to fiat currency and dispensed as cash.

The Advantages of Crypto Debit Cards

One of the main advantages of crypto debit cards is convenience. Users can spend their cryptocurrency without having to exchange it first, which can save time and money. These cards also offer a way to use cryptocurrency in the real world, which can increase its adoption and utility.

Another advantage of crypto debit cards is security. These cards use the same security measures as traditional debit cards, such as chip and pin technology. This makes them a safe and secure way to spend cryptocurrency.

The Disadvantages of Crypto Debit Cards

One of the main disadvantages of crypto debit cards is their fees. These cards often have higher fees than traditional debit cards, including transaction fees and foreign exchange fees. Additionally, some cards have monthly or annual fees, which can add up over time.

Another disadvantage of crypto debit cards is their availability. These cards are not yet widely available and may not be accepted at all merchants. This can limit their usefulness and make it difficult for users to spend their cryptocurrency.
